suchen
HeimPHP-BibliothekenAndere BibliothekenPHP-Implementierungscodeklasse im Singleton-Modus
PHP-Implementierungscodeklasse im Singleton-ModusEinführung einer Single-Mode-PHP-Implementierungscodeklasse. Die getInstance()-Methode muss auf public gesetzt sein und diese Methode muss aufgerufen werden. Object-Methoden können nicht auf gewöhnliche Objekteigenschaften zugreifen, daher muss $_instance festgelegt werden statisch
Haftungsausschluss

Alle Ressourcen auf dieser Website werden von Internetnutzern bereitgestellt oder von großen Download-Sites nachgedruckt. Bitte überprüfen Sie selbst die Integrität der Software! Alle Ressourcen auf dieser Website dienen nur als Referenz zum Lernen. Bitte nutzen Sie diese nicht für kommerzielle Zwecke. Andernfalls sind Sie für alle Folgen verantwortlich! Wenn ein Verstoß vorliegt, kontaktieren Sie uns bitte, um ihn zu löschen. Kontaktinformationen: admin@php.cn

Verwandter Artikel

Teilen im Singleton-ModusTeilen im Singleton-Modus

18Jul2017

Singleton-Muster: Es handelt sich um ein häufig verwendetes Software-Designmuster, das in seiner Kernstruktur eine spezielle Klasse namens Singleton enthält. Eine Klasse hat nur eine Instanz, das heißt, eine Klasse hat nur eine Objektinstanz. Für einige Klassen im System ist nur eine Instanz wichtig. Beispielsweise kann es in einem System mehrere Druckaufgaben geben, aber beim Verkauf von Tickets kann es insgesamt 100 Tickets geben Tickets werden in mehreren Fenstern gleichzeitig verkauft, es muss jedoch sichergestellt werden, dass es nicht zu einer Überbuchung kommt (die verbleibende Anzahl an Tickets ist hier eine einzige Instanz und der Ticketverkauf erfordert Multi-Threading). Wenn kein Mechanismus zur Eindeutigkeit des Fensterobjekts verwendet würde, würde der

Detaillierte Erläuterung der Verwendung des PHP-Singleton-Modus und des Factory-ModusDetaillierte Erläuterung der Verwendung des PHP-Singleton-Modus und des Factory-Modus

29Mar2018

Ein Entwurfsmuster ist eine Reihe klassifizierter und katalogisierter Code-Entwurfserfahrungen, die wiederholt verwendet werden und den meisten Menschen bekannt sind. Der Zweck der Verwendung von Entwurfsmustern besteht darin, Code wiederzuverwenden, ihn für andere verständlicher zu machen und die Zuverlässigkeit des Codes sicherzustellen. Es besteht kein Zweifel, dass Entwurfsmuster eine Win-Win-Situation für einen selbst, andere und das System darstellen. Entwurfsmuster machen die Codierung zu einem echten Engineering. Entwurfsmuster sind der Grundpfeiler der Softwareentwicklung, genau wie die Struktur eines Gebäudes.

Detaillierte Beispiele für den PHP-Singleton-Modus und den Factory-ModusDetaillierte Beispiele für den PHP-Singleton-Modus und den Factory-Modus

29Mar2018

Ein Entwurfsmuster ist eine Reihe klassifizierter und katalogisierter Code-Entwurfserfahrungen, die wiederholt verwendet werden und den meisten Menschen bekannt sind. Der Zweck der Verwendung von Entwurfsmustern besteht darin, Code wiederzuverwenden, den Code für andere leichter verständlich zu machen und die Codezuverlässigkeit sicherzustellen.

Ausführliche Erläuterung der Anwendungsbeispiele des PHP-Singleton-Modus und des Factory-ModusAusführliche Erläuterung der Anwendungsbeispiele des PHP-Singleton-Modus und des Factory-Modus

30Jun2017

Ein Entwurfsmuster ist eine Reihe klassifizierter und katalogisierter Code-Entwurfserfahrungen, die wiederholt verwendet werden und den meisten Menschen bekannt sind. Der Zweck der Verwendung von Entwurfsmustern besteht darin, Code wiederzuverwenden, ihn für andere verständlicher zu machen und die Zuverlässigkeit des Codes sicherzustellen.

Flash-Vorgangsschritte im Singleton-ModusFlash-Vorgangsschritte im Singleton-Modus

10Apr2024

1. Erstellen Sie eine Klasse mit dem Namen „Example“ und speichern Sie sie in einem festen Ordner. 2. Definieren Sie eine statische private Variable isopen, der Typ sind boolesche Daten, und setzen Sie den Anfangswert auf true. 3. Definieren Sie den Konstruktor der Klasse Beispiel. 4. Verwenden Sie die if-Anweisung, um eine Beurteilung zu treffen. Wenn der Wert von isopen wahr ist, führen Sie den if-Anweisungskörper aus. 5. Geben Sie die Testdaten für die Ausführung des if-Anweisungskörpers aus und verwenden Sie die Trace-Methode, um sie zu implementieren. 6. Setzen Sie den Wert von isopen auf false, damit das Programm den Konstruktor nicht ein zweites Mal aufrufen kann. 7. Wenn der Konstruktor schließlich erneut aufgerufen wird, wird die Eingabeaufforderung [Instanz kann nicht erstellt werden] angezeigt. 8. Erstellen Sie ein neues Flash-Dokument und speichern Sie es im selben Ordner wie die Klasse.

Detaillierte Erläuterung der Verwendung des Singleton-Modus und des Factory-Modus von PHPDetaillierte Erläuterung der Verwendung des Singleton-Modus und des Factory-Modus von PHP

30Mar2018

Ein Entwurfsmuster ist eine Reihe klassifizierter und katalogisierter Code-Entwurfserfahrungen, die wiederholt verwendet werden und den meisten Menschen bekannt sind. Der Zweck der Verwendung von Entwurfsmustern besteht darin, Code wiederzuverwenden, ihn für andere verständlicher zu machen und die Zuverlässigkeit des Codes sicherzustellen. Es besteht kein Zweifel, dass Entwurfsmuster eine Win-Win-Situation für einen selbst, andere und das System darstellen. Entwurfsmuster machen die Codierung zu einem echten Engineering. Entwurfsmuster sind der Grundpfeiler der Softwareentwicklung, genau wie die Struktur eines Gebäudes. Singleton-Muster Das Singleton-Muster ist sehr nützlich, wenn Sie sicherstellen müssen, dass es nur eine Instanz eines Objekts geben kann. Es delegiert die Kontrolle über die Objekterstellung an einen einzigen Punkt.

See all articles